Dear admin,

There is bug in package setting, if you set a ccTLD domain create the shortest ccTLD first before it child, you can see a bug in the price.
The price of child ccTLD is overwritten by the shortest ccTLD

Example:

i am add the .id domain first

The i add the .web.id domain

The price of .web.id is overwritten by .id domain price
